Why Do Cats Need to Be Bathed?

Cats can become quite dirty and unkempt if they are not groomed regularly. Cats that are not groomed can develop mats in their fur and their coats can become matted and greasy. In addition, if cats are not groomed, they can develop skin conditions such as dandruff, dry skin, and other skin problems. Grooming cats helps to keep their coats healthy and free of mats and tangles.

Bathing cats also helps to get rid of any fleas or other parasites that may be living on their fur. Fleas and other parasites can cause skin irritations and can even lead to more serious health problems if left untreated. In addition, cats that are not bathed regularly may have an unpleasant odor, which can be off-putting to both other cats and humans.

How Do Cat Groomers Bathe Cats?

Cat groomers use a variety of techniques to bathe cats. Some groomers may use a hose and a shampoo specifically formulated for cats, while others may use a combination of water and a mild soap. Before beginning the bath, the groomer will brush the cat’s coat to remove any tangles and mats.

Once the coat is brushed, the cat will be placed in a bathtub or sink, and the groomer will begin to wet the cat down. The groomer will then apply the shampoo to the cat’s coat, making sure to lather it up thoroughly. Finally, the groomer will rinse the cat off with warm water, and then use a towel to dry them off.
